What is a Meta internship?

Meta Internships are paid work experiences offered by Meta (formerly Facebook) to students and recent graduates interested in various fields such as software engineering, data science, product management, design, and more. These internships typically last 12 to 16 weeks and provide interns with the opportunity to work on real projects, collaborate with experienced professionals, and gain hands-on experience in the tech industry. Interns also benefit from mentorship, networking events, and access to learning resources. Meta Internships are highly competitive and are available in multiple locations worldwide.

What types of projects do Meta interns typically work on, and how do these projects contribute to the company's goals?

Meta interns are often assigned to impactful, real-world projects that align with the company's strategic objectives in areas like software engineering, data analysis, product design, and research. Interns collaborate closely with full-time employees, participate in team meetings, and contribute code or insights that may be integrated into live products or services. The work environment is fast-paced and collaborative, giving interns the opportunity to learn from experienced professionals while making meaningful contributions. These projects not only help develop technical and professional skills but also allow interns to see the tangible impact of their work within Meta.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Meta intern,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Meta Intern, you generally need strong analytical abilities, problem-solving skills, and relevant academic coursework in your field of interest, such as computer science, business, or design. Familiarity with Meta's tech stack, programming languages (like Python or JavaScript), and collaborative tools (such as GitHub or Slack) is often expected, and having relevant certifications can be advantageous. Strong communication, adaptability, and a proactive attitude help interns stand out by enabling effective teamwork and initiative. These skills are essential for contributing meaningfully to projects, learning quickly, and making a positive impression in a highly competitive environment.

Fall 2026 - Media Buying Internship

In addition to significant professional development, mentorship, and real-world project experience, participants will be considered for a one-time, performance-based payment at the conclusion of the program. The amount depends on business and individual results.

Bauer Entertainment Marketing (BEM) is seeking a highly organized, detail-oriented Media Buying Intern to support our traditional and digital media team. This internship offers hands-on experience working with advertising campaigns for concerts, festivals, performing arts centers, fairs, sporting events, and other live entertainment clients across the country.

You will gain hands-on experience supporting both traditional and digital advertising initiatives while learning the operations of a full-service marketing agency. Responsibilities include:

  • Assist with traditional media buys including radio, print, television, outdoor, and digital out-of-home
  • Organize and traffic creative assets to media partners
  • Track campaign budgets and reconcile media invoices
  • Pull campaign performance metrics and assist with reporting
  • Prepare campaign recap presentations
  • Research media outlets and advertising opportunities
  • Draft radio scripts and advertising copy points
  • Assist with media schedules and production timelines
  • Conduct audience and market research
  • Support digital advertising campaigns across Meta, Google, TikTok, and Programmatic platforms

This is an excellent opportunity for a student interested in advertising, media buying, marketing analytics, or entertainment marketing who wants real-world agency experience.

This internship requires a minimum commitment of three days per week. Specific days and hours can be coordinated with your supervisor based on business needs and academic schedules.

This position reports to the Senior Media Buyer and supports our team of project managers and account coordinators. You'll work alongside experienced marketing professionals and contribute to campaigns for nationally recognized music, sports, and entertainment brands.

This is an internship that will correspond with your educational study/school credit requirements.

This internship can be done from our workspace in East Nashville and/or remotely.

The length of the internship has an expected, but flexible, start in August and completion in December.
